University Career Services
UCS provides students with career decision-making assistance and helps them identify and pursue career opportunities. Through career fairs, panels, campus recruiting and other programs, students get direct exposure to employers with high quality entry-level and internship opportunities and important career and employer information.
Students registered with UCS can:
- Access online career guidance and employment research tools
- Make appointments for individual career counseling
- Participate in Practice with Professionals mock interviews and have resumes critiqued
- Receive e-mail notifications of career related programs targeted to your interest or major
- Broaden your opportunities by placing your resume in a customized resume database that employers search to fill career and internship positions
Alumni Career Services
The Alumni Association offers a comprehensive program of career services to assist Georgia State alumni with ongoing career management. Offered as a benefit of membership in the Alumni Association, these programs are available in person, by telephone and via Internet access.
